Ingredients And Substitutions
These are the main ingredients and substitutions for Pumpkin Butter. Scroll down to the recipe card for a full list of ingredients and instructions.
Use canned pumpkin puree and not pumpkin pie filling.
Maple syrup gives this pumpkin butter a delicious caramel flavor, you may sub date syrup, agave or honey.
Coconut sugar contains healthy fats and is one of my favorite sugars. You may also use brown sugar or cane sugar in replace.
A touch of lemon juice helps add a bit of tang and acidity to this pumpkin butter recipe. Use fresh lemon juice for best results.
A touch of vanilla extract makes any baked good better.
You can’t have pumpkin butter without pumpkin pie spice, this is highly encouraged. If you don’t have any or can’t find it, you can use extra cinnamon instead.
I personally love using apple cider in my pumpkin butter for a much sweeter taste, if you don’t like apple, then you can use water instead. Apple juice will work as well.

How To Make
ONE: Start by adding all the ingredients to a saucepan over medium to low heat and stir until well combined. Bring mixture to a slow simmer and let it sit there for roughly 15-20 minutes, stirring occasionally.


TWO: The pumpkin butter will turn from bright orange to a deep dark brown color. Remove from heat, let cool slightly, then store in an airtight container in the fridge.


Tips And Tricks
Watch the pumpkin butter carefully and keep stirring occasionally so that it doesn’t burn.
Don’t let the mixture come to a full boil, only a slow simmer.
Let mixture cool to room temperature before storing.
How To Serve And Store
Serve this pumpkin butter on toast, in smoothies, on top of oatmeal or yogurt bowls, in coffee, cocktails, mocktails and so much more! The possibilities are endless. Think of using this Pumpkin Butter in replace of almond or peanut butter.
Store in an airtight container in the fridge and enjoy within 3 weeks, or freeze and enjoy up to 3 months.
Taste And Texture
This pumpkin butter is incredibly sweet with delicious pumpkin flavor and undertones of apple.
The texture is creamy and smooth, think of a spreadable jam.
